
Fall Season Continues in Alabama
October 23, 2025 02:35 PM | Golf
MORGANTOWN, W.Va. – The West Virginia University golf team continues its fall season at the Steelwood Collegiate Invitational at Steelwood Country Club in Loxley, Alabama, this weekend.
Golfers will play 36 holes on Saturday, beginning at 8:30 a.m. local time, followed by 18 holes on Sunday.
No. 35 West Virginia will compete against No. 23 Wake Forest, No. 33 Purdue, No. 38 Texas A&M, No. 51 Rice, No. 54 Kansas State, No. 64 South Alabama, No. 66 Nebraska, No. 67 Memphis, No. 78 Rutgers, No. 89 Kennesaw State, No. 95 Iowa State, No. 113 Virginia Tech and Louisiana Tech.
WVU's lineup will consist of seniors Westy McCabe and Kaleb Wilson, sophomores Ryan Leach and Nick Turowski and freshman Jack Michael.
